Getting Serious

Hermann Simon

Chapter 4 in Many Worlds, One Life, 2021, pp 53-65 from Springer

Abstract: Abstract How do you decide on a field of study? My interest in business and economics grew during my military service. The University of Bonn, Germany’s leader in economics, was a natural choice. So I got serious. But learning is not only about studying. Social and political experiences are just as important. New opportunities opened up, and I focused on marketing with the ambition to find ways to combine theory and practice more effectively. The world of academics and research had captured me, and I began to build my international academic network.
